The heat generated in a circuit is dependent upon the resistance, current and time for which the current is flown. If the error in measuring the above are 1%, 2% and 1% respectively, then maximum error in measuring the heat is

Text Solution

Verified by Experts

Heat `H= (i^(2)RT)/(j)`
Maximum error in measuring the heat
`(Delta H)/(H) xx 100 = 2 (Delta i)/(i) xx 100 + (Delta R)/(R ) xx 100 + (Delta T)/(T) xx 100`
Here J is a constant
Given that `(Delta R)/(R ) xx 100=1%, (Delta i)/(i) xx 100 = 2% (Delta T)/(T ) xx 100 = 1%`
`(Delta H)/(H) xx 100= (2 xx 2) + 1 + 1 = 4 + 1+ 1`
Maximum error in heat = 6%
